What is the Greatest Common Factor of 20008 and 20027?

Greatest common factor (GCF) of 20008 and 20027 is 1.

GCF(20008,20027) = 1

How to find the GCF of 20008 and 20027?

We will first find the prime factorization of 20008 and 20027. After we will calculate the factors of 20008 and 20027 and find the biggest common factor number .

Step-1: Prime Factorization of 20008

Prime factors of 20008 are 2, 41, 61. Prime factorization of 20008 in exponential form is:

20008 = 23 × 411 × 611

Step-2: Prime Factorization of 20027

Prime factors of 20027 are 7, 2861. Prime factorization of 20027 in exponential form is:

20027 = 71 × 28611

Step-3: Factors of 20008

List of positive integer factors of 20008 that divides 20008 without a remainder.

1, 2, 4, 8, 41, 61, 82, 122, 164, 244, 328, 488, 2501, 5002, 10004

Step-4: Factors of 20027

List of positive integer factors of 20027 that divides 20008 without a remainder.

1, 7, 2861

Final Step: Biggest Common Factor Number

We found the factors and prime factorization of 20008 and 20027. The biggest common factor number is the GCF number.
So the greatest common factor 20008 and 20027 is 1.
